Angela Okorie Calls Out Zubby Michael Again for Rocking Red T-Shirt to Junior Pope’s FuneralZubby Michael, a well-known actor, was spotted graciously offering bundles of cash to Junior Pope’s family amidst criticism regarding his attire at the funeral of the deceased actor.
It is worth noting that Zubby Michael faced backlash from both his peers and supporters for his choice of clothing at Junior Pope’s funeral.
A video capturing the actor taking cash from a bag and presenting it to his late friend’s family during the funeral circulated widely.
Despite his intention to display kindness through this generous act, he faced disapproval from fans who viewed it as a show of extravagance and deemed it unwarranted.
